我正在创建一个帐户页面,人们可以看到他们的“硬币”,这是我目前正在创建的网站上的货币。我设置了数据库和表格,它只是没有显示。
以下是表格:管理员中存储的ID,用户名,密码,电子邮件,横幅,硬币,管理员,图片,状态,设计和推特。
<?php
session_start();
include('global.php');
$getNotification = mysql_query("SELECT * FROM stage") or die(mysql_error());
$getStats = mysql_query("SELECT * FROM admin") or die(mysql_error());
$note= mysql_query("SELECT * FROM notifications ORDER BY id DESC LIMIT 5") or die(mysql_error());
$result = mysql_query("SELECT * FROM admin WHERE username='$login_session'");
$admin = $row['admin'];
while($row = mysql_fetch_array( $result )) {
$coins= $row['coins'];
//if (($row['ipbanned']=="1"))
//{
//header("location: ipbanned.php");
//}
//}
}
if (($session_username))
{
}
else
{
header("location: index.php");
}
$off = mysql_query("SELECT * FROM siteoffline WHERE site='http://intervention.hostei.com/'");
if (($row['offline']=="1"))
{
header("location: underdev.php");
}
?>
<html>
<head>
<title>Intervention</title>
<link rel="stylesheet" type="text/css" href="/style.css">
<head>
</head>
<body>
<?php include('./include/logonav.php') ?>
<div id="content">
<div id="account">
<center><font size="5" width="100%"><?php echo $session_username; ?>'s Home</font></center>
<font id="avatar">
IMAGE HERE C:
</font>
<font id="notitications">
<center>
<u><b>Notifications</b></u>
<?
while($ra = mysql_fetch_array( $note )) {
echo '<div id="bn" style="width:220px; display:block;">';
echo nl2br($ra['body']);
echo '<br><br>Posted by: ';
echo $ra['name'];
echo '<br>';
$time = time();
$get_time = $ra['date'];
$diff = $time - $get_time;
switch(1)
{
case ($diff < 60):
$count = $diff;
if ($count==0)
$count = "A moment";
else if ($count==1)
$suffix = "second";
else
$suffix = "seconds";
break;
case ($diff > 60 && $diff < 3600):
$count = floor($diff/60);
if ($count==1)
$suffix = "minute";
else
$suffix = "minutes";
break;
case ($diff > 3600 && $diff < 86400):
$count = floor($diff/3600);
if ($count==1)
$suffix = "hour";
else
$suffix = "hours";
break;
case ($diff > 86400 && $diff < 604800):
$count = floor($diff/86400);
if ($count==1)
$suffix = "day";
else
$suffix = "days";
break;
case ($diff > 604800 && $diff < 2629743):
$count = floor($diff/604800);
if ($count==1)
$suffix = "week";
else
$suffix = "weeks";
break;
case ($diff > 2629743 && $diff < 31556926):
$count = floor($diff/2629743);
if ($count==1)
$suffix = "month";
else
$suffix = "months";
break;
case ($diff > 31556926):
$count = floor($diff/31556926);
if ($count==1)
$suffix = "year";
else
$suffix = "years";
break;
}
echo "".$count." ".$suffix." ago";
}
?>
</center>
</font>
<font id="statistics">
<center>
<u><b>Statistics</b></u>
<br />
Coins:
<?
while($rap = mysql_fetch_array( $getStats )) {
echo " ";
}
?>
</center>
</font>
<font id="badges">
<center><u><b>Badges</b></u></center>
</font>
</div>
</div>
<?php include('./include/footer.php') ?>
</body>
</html>
答案 0 :(得分:0)
你说硬币没有显示..
这里`
<font id="statistics">
<center>
<u><b>Statistics</b></u>
<br />
Coins:
<?
while($rap = mysql_fetch_array( $getStats )) {
echo " ";
}
?>
</center>
</font>`
你只回显空字符串:echo“”; 同时把一些来自$ rap变量
print_r($rap);